PMI-ACP — Prerequisites

2,000 hours general project experience + 1,500 hours agile experience + 21 hours agile education

CISM — Prerequisites

5 years information security management experience

Frequently asked questions

Is PMI-ACP harder than CISM?

CISM is harder — rated advanced vs intermediate.

Which pays more — PMI-ACP or CISM?

PMI-ACP has an average salary uplift of +$15,000/yr, while CISM has +$20,000/yr. CISM has the higher salary impact.
